Can you wax wood floors?
Use liquid wax or oil on unvarnished hardwood, linoleum, or unfinished cork. Follow label instructions. It is easier to apply than paste wax, but the finish doesn't last as long. Do NOT use on no-wax floors, vinyl, or urethane-finished floors.

Is it cheaper to refinish or replace hardwood floors?
In general, it will almost ALWAYS be less expensive to refinish your hardwood floors. If you replace them, you need to pay for additional wood as well as ripping up and hauling away existing hardwood.
